How much does online reputation management cost?
The cost of online reputation management can vary significantly based on the scope and complexity of the tasks involved. On average, the cost can range from $500 to $10,000 per month. However, it is important to note that these are just rough estimates, and the actual cost can go higher or lower depending on the specific needs of each individual or organization.
When considering the cost of online reputation management, it is crucial to understand that ORM is not a one-time investment but an ongoing process. Building and maintaining a strong online reputation requires continuous effort and monitoring. As a result, many reputation management agencies offer monthly subscription plans to ensure that your online reputation stays protected and improved over time.
What factors affect the cost of online reputation management?
The following factors can influence the cost of online reputation management services:
1. Scope of work: The complexity of the issues being addressed and the extent of the reputation management required will impact the cost.
2. Size of the online presence: The more extensive and diverse your online presence is, the more it will cost to manage and monitor.
3. Timeframe: Urgent or time-sensitive reputation issues may require additional resources and thus incur higher costs.
4. Reputation severity: The extent of damage to your online reputation will influence the effort and resources needed to restore it.
5. Industry: Certain industries face more online scrutiny and may require specialized reputation management strategies, which can impact the cost.
6. Geographical reach: If you are a local business, the cost may be lower compared to a global organization with a larger online presence.
What services are typically included in online reputation management?
Online reputation management services can include a variety of tasks and strategies to improve and protect an individual’s or business’s online reputation. These services often include:
1. Monitoring online mentions and reviews.
2. Content creation and promotion to enhance positive visibility.
3. Social media management and engagement.
4. Search engine optimization (SEO) to ensure positive content ranks higher in search results.
5. Crisis management and reputation repair.
6. Removal of negative content where possible or suppression in search results.
Are there any additional costs involved in online reputation management?
In addition to the monthly subscription or service fee, there might be additional costs associated with online reputation management. These could include:
1. Content creation: If you need new positive content to be developed or existing content to be optimized, there may be additional costs involved.
2. Advertising: Occasionally, online reputation management agencies may recommend running targeted ads to counteract negative content or promote positive aspects of your brand or image.
3. Legal services: If you require legal assistance to remove defamatory content or deal with online abuse, it may result in additional costs.

Can online reputation management prevent all negative content?
While professional online reputation management can greatly minimize negative content and its impact, it cannot guarantee complete eradication. The aim of ORM is to actively manage, respond, and suppress negative content to ultimately overshadow it with positive information.
How long does it take to see results with online reputation management?
The timeframe for seeing results in online reputation management can vary depending on the current state of your reputation, the severity of the issues, and the strategies implemented. In some cases, minor improvements can be noticed within weeks, while more significant changes may take several months.
